Chapters: 0:00 A nuclear bomber with backward propellers 1:16 Pusher vs. Puller airplanes 1:50 Why early airplanes had a pusher design? 2:43 The advantage of putting the propeller in the back 3:49 Why putting propellers in the back makes more noise 5:44 Why pusher aircraft are more sensitive to FOD 7:22 Engine cooling complexities with pusher configuration aircraft 8:55 Why did many WWI aircraft had propellers on the back? (Fokker's Interrupter Mechanism) 10:32 Increased dynamic stability with the puller configuration 11:35 Why ship propellers are on the back, not front Interested to join our team?
